Weekend and 3 day courses will include the following elements:-
|
|
- Dismantling and cleaning old repairs
- Reattaching broken pieces
- Modelling a small missing piece (e.g. an ear or a flower)
- Filling small chips
- Colour matching
- Handpainting
- Glazing and finishing
|
5 day courses will also include the following areas:-
|
- Stabilising hairlines and cracks
- Molding larger missing pieces
- "Cuffing" - a technique for accurately repairing badly damaged breaks
- Airbrushing Demonstration
- Airbrushing practice (time permittting)

Obviously learning to restore ceramics to a high standard takes time, patience and practice, and we're not promising to turn you into
a master professional in a weekend! However, we aim to equip you with all of the knowledge and techniques you require to be able to work
on and complete restoration projects at home.
Please note: although we aim to send you home with at least one fully completed item we cannot guarantee that you will achieve this
while on the course - that depends on the complexity of the repair and how quickly you pick up the techniques.
However, we DO guarantee that you will know how to finish all your pieces, and we are available by email or phone if you have any problems - or,
of course, you could come and see us again.
